Selecting a Channel by using
Channel Search Button
This feature allows you to do a quick search for a specific
channel in your radio by keying in the alias of the channel.
Your radio prompts the first found channel if a match is
found.
1 Perform one of the following actions:
Press the preprogrammed Channel Search
button.
or to CSrh and press the Menu Select button
directly below CSrh.
A blinking cursor appears on the Channel Search
screen.
2 Use the keypad to type or edit your channel name.
3 To initiate searching, press the Menu Select button
directly below CSrh once the entry is done.
To exit this procedure, press the Menu Select button
directly below Cncl .
One of the following scenarios occurs:
The display shows Searching. Once found, the display
shows the matched channel name and the radio
changes its transmission to the selected channel.
If the radio is triggered to search for an empty entry, the
display shows Invalid entry. Repeat step 2 to search
again.
If the entry does not match, the display shows Channel
name not found.Repeat step 2 to search again; or
press
or the Menu Select button directly below Exit
to exit.
Mode Select Feature
Mode Select allows a long press to save the current zone
and channel of your radio to a programmable button,
keypad button, or a softkey; then once programmed, the
short-press of that button or softkey changes the
transmission to the saved zone and channel.
